Directions Toward Independence Directions Toward Independence offers training to people who live independently. Through the program, funded by Tri-Counties Regional Center, skills such as shopping, cooking, money management, community mobility, handling checking and savings accounts, interpersonal relationships, making change, learning to tell time and others are taught to the clients. Most of the training is one-on-one with each session highly customized for maximum progress. Training is usually offered in the privacy of each person's home, although there are times that a session may take place in the community, such as in the case of shopping skills, community orientation and understanding traffic and pedestrian signage. Free out-of-town excursions and craft classes are also offered through DTI FUN DAY. The DTI program also handles minor crisis intervention and assists with many miscellaneous needs that an individual may encounter. The program acts as a liaison between the consumer and Adult Protective Services, Child Protective Services, legal assistance, the police, the Housing Authority and many other agencies. The program's focus is on the consumer's rights and treating them with respect. Each consumer has a great deal of say regarding what independent living skills they wish to study. We currently offer services in three languages: English, Spanish, and Hmong. |
